Rough Draft of Stuck in Neutral Terry Truemans Stuck in Neutral is around a boy who has Cerebral Palsy and yet loves his life. Shawn McDaniels has a lot of problems but he stiff optimistic. His CP has left him totally disabled he is unable to walk, talk, eat, or communicate. Although Shawn acknowledges that there is Bad News closely his existence, he focuses on the positives in his life. Shawn loves his family deeply and appreciates people.
